What does Proverbs 24:3-5 really mean?

Proverbs 24:3-5 is about the importance of wisdom, understanding, and knowledge in building a strong and secure life, and how with these qualities one can establish a firm foundation and have success in all endeavors.

3 By wisdom a house is built,
and by understanding it is established;
4 by knowledge the rooms are filled with all precious and pleasant riches.
5 A wise man is full of strength,
and a man of knowledge enhances his might,

Understanding what Proverbs 24:3-5 really means

Proverbs 24:3-5 delves into the essence of wisdom, understanding, and knowledge as fundamental pillars in constructing a robust and flourishing life. Just as a well-built house requires more than mere physical labor, a well-founded life necessitates virtues and insights that go beyond the surface.

Wisdom, the cornerstone of this passage, is depicted as the bedrock upon which a stable and enduring life is erected. It entails making decisions that are not only intellectually astute but also morally upright and spiritually guided. Understanding, as mentioned, serves to fortify and consolidate the foundation laid by wisdom. It involves profound comprehension and the adept application of acquired knowledge. Knowledge, the final piece of the puzzle, enriches life by filling it with valuable experiences and insights, both material and spiritual.

Drawing parallels from other biblical passages, James 1:5 underscores the significance of seeking divine wisdom, emphasizing God’s willingness to bestow wisdom generously upon those who ask. The parable in Matthew 7:24-27 stresses the importance of building one’s life on a solid foundation, rooted in the teachings of Jesus. Colossians 2:2-3 further expounds on the treasures of wisdom and knowledge found in Christ, highlighting the profound riches that come from understanding His teachings.
